Black Star: A Story Of Self-Repatriation To Africa (History Documentary) | Real Stories Original
Published in Documentary Blog
After being hassled by the police in Oakland, California, African-American musician Sunru Carter decided to 'repatriate' himself to Ghana. He retraced the journey of his great-grandfather who had been enslaved in Ghana; sold in Charlottesville, Virginia; and taken to work on the plantation of James Monroe, 5th President of the United States.
